Top 5 Perks of Booking a Resort Cabin in Pigeon Forge for Your Next Getaway

Staying in a resort cabin gives you access to exclusive amenities reserved just for the resort’s residents. Here are the top perks of renting a resort cabin in Pigeon Forge.

1. Swimming Pool Access

Pools are the true gems of resort living. Many resorts feature seasonal, outdoor pools, and some have indoor pools so you can swim year-round, in any weather. Lounge on the pool deck with a book or your favorite podcast. Then join the kids in the water to play Marco Polo.

2. Outdoor Amenities

Imagine stepping out of your cabin and setting off on a stroll in the fresh air. No need to drive anywhere! Just head for your resort’s walking trails. Because these paths and trails are private, you won’t have to deal with crowds. 

Some resorts boast breathtaking views from picnic spots where you can spread out a feast. You’re close to your cabin, so it’s easy to dash back if you forgot the ketchup!

Anglers of all ages will love having their own fishing pond. At Hideaway Ridge, you can spend a lazy day fishing or just watching dragonflies flit over the water.   

Look for other outdoor amenities like playgrounds, tennis courts, and community fire pits. 

3. Clubhouses

Some clubhouses feature community rooms you can reserve for events. Why not bring your extended family to Pigeon Forge for a birthday or anniversary, and hold a party at the clubhouse? Some clubhouses have games like ping pong, foosball, or video games for everyone to play. Cabins at Hidden Springs Resort include access to a clubhouse with a delightful game room.

4. Privacy

Resorts provide greater privacy than most communities. Some resorts are gated, so the only folks you’ll encounter are other guests. 

5. Ideal Locations

Want to stay near a specific attraction? Choose a resort where you’ll be neighbors with your favorite activity. Spend your precious vacation time at your destination–not in your car trying to get there!

A great example is Golf View Resort, next to Gatlinburg Golf Course. Play on this public course to your heart’s content. Once you leave the links, you’re only moments away from the resort’s indoor and outdoor pools, sauna, and picnic pavilion with its own outdoor kitchen. Some Pigeon Forge resorts are near Dollywood, or minutes from the exciting Parkway.
